The Leopard Book

In the spring of 1860 Fabrizio the charismatic Prince of Salina rules over thousands of acres and hundreds of people including his own numerous family in mingled splendour and squalor. Then comes Garibaldi's landing in Sicily and the Prince must decide whether to resist the forces of change or come to terms with them.Read More
